Transaction 304881af7ddeef6186f01b1f0872efb01d5919e0a062c4f1271b6716399fa449
1 Input
1 Output
-
304881af7ddeef6186f01b1f0872efb01d5919e0a062c4f1271b6716399fa449:0
- value
- 2720492
- script pubkey
- OP_0 OP_PUSHBYTES_20 caa46f81dfa68de9ee3fb4f6106ed4f0018461ee
- address
- bc1qe2jxlqwl56x7nm3lknmpqmk57qqcgc0wd2c56g